+From: John Johnansen
+Subject: log audit message type so it is present in syslog
+Patch-mainline: no
+References: 304491
+
+Audit messages that go to syslog don't contain the audit type, which
+the apparmor tools use to classify messages. This patch logs the audit
+type as part of the AppArmor message so it is present in messages sent
+to syslog.
+
+Signed-off-by: John Johansen
+
+---
+ security/apparmor/main.c | 4 +++-
+ 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
+
+--- a/security/apparmor/main.c
++++ b/security/apparmor/main.c
+@@ -326,8 +326,10 @@ static int aa_audit_base(struct aa_profi
+ return type == AUDIT_APPARMOR_ALLOWED ? 0 : -ENOMEM;
+ }
+
++ audit_log_format(ab, " type=%d", type);
++
+ if (sa->operation)
+- audit_log_format(ab, "operation=\"%s\"", sa->operation);
++ audit_log_format(ab, " operation=\"%s\"", sa->operation);
+
+ if (sa->info)
+ audit_log_format(ab, " info=\"%s\"", sa->info);
